Raccomandato, 2024

Scelta Del Redattore

Come costruire Smart Speaker con Alexa e Google Assistant (fai da te)

In questi giorni, gli assistenti intelligenti stanno conquistando il mondo della tecnologia. Alexa di Amazon e Assistente di Google sono ora incorporati in ogni dispositivo, che si tratti di dispositivi per auto, docce o quasi tutto ciò che è stato presentato al CES 2018. Ma nonostante tutto ciò, i dispositivi più venduti con questi assistenti sono i prodotti dell'azienda, che è, Amazon Echo e Google Home.

Mentre entrambi gli altoparlanti intelligenti sono fantastici da soli, non sarebbe bello avere il potere di entrambi su un unico dispositivo? Bene, ora puoi. Noi di Beebom abbiamo creato la nostra guida su come creare il tuo smart speaker con le funzionalità sia di Google Assistant che di Amazon Alexa. Quindi, senza ulteriori indugi, iniziamo subito.

Nota : il seguente progetto è stato creato con l'aiuto di un progetto GitHub.

Cose di cui hai bisogno:

  • Raspberry Pi 3 (collegamento)
  • microSD Card 32 GB (collegamento)
  • Caricatore USB da parete (collegamento)
  • Hub USB a 3 porte (collegamento)
  • Cavo da USB-A a microUSB (collegamento)
  • Microfono USB (collegamento)
  • Altoparlante portatile con ingresso AUX (link)
  • Tastiera e mouse (collegamento)
  • Display con porta HDMI (collegamento)
  • Cavo HDMI (collegamento)

Passi per costruire Smart Speaker:

1. Per iniziare, devi prima configurare il tuo Raspberry Pi. Per farlo, scarica semplicemente il pacchetto NOOBS, estrailo nella tua scheda microSD e collegalo al tuo Raspberry Pi . Collega la tastiera USB, il mouse, il microfono e l'altoparlante al Pi e accendilo. Ora otterrai una prima configurazione. Basta selezionare Debian e installare per avviare l'installazione di Debian sul tuo Raspberry Pi.

2. Ora, devi creare il tuo account sviluppatore Amazon e creare un profilo di sicurezza . Puoi anche seguire le istruzioni del progetto GitHub. Una volta terminato, annota le credenziali dell'account Amazon.

Successivamente, crea un account sviluppatore Google e attiva l'API Assistente Google. Una volta completato, scarica il file credentials.json del tuo prodotto Google in / home / pi e rinominalo in assistant.json.

3. Ora, esegui i seguenti comandi uno per uno per clonare il progetto GitHub e rendere eseguibili i file del programma di installazione :

 git clone https ://github.com/shivasiddharth/Assistants-Pi sudo chmod +x /home/ pi /Assistants- Pi /prep- system .sh sudo chmod +x /home/ pi /Assistants- Pi /audio-test.sh sudo chmod +x /home/ pi /Assistants- Pi /installer.sh sudo /home/ pi /Assistants- Pi /prep- system .sh 

Innanzitutto, il sistema operativo verrà aggiornato e aggiornato. Successivamente, ti verrà richiesto di selezionare l'impostazione audio. Seleziona "3" dalle opzioni . Ora, riavvia il Raspberry Pi.

4. Al riavvio, innanzitutto, controlla la configurazione audio di

 sudo /home/ pi /Assistants-Pi/ audio-test.sh 

Lo script è interattivo, basta premere "y" se senti l'audio, o "n" se non lo fai. Nel caso in cui non si sente l'audio, è necessario controllare i fili.

5. Ora che il sistema è pronto, eseguire il seguente comando per avviare l'installazione :

 sudo /home/ pi /Assistants-Pi/i nstaller.sh 

Lo script verrà ora eseguito. È uno script piuttosto semplice, basta seguire le istruzioni sullo schermo.

6. Una volta installati entrambi gli assistenti, verrà visualizzata una schermata come di seguito. Esegui i comandi uno per uno per autenticare Alexa . Una volta completato questo, apporta le modifiche nel file README situato in / home / pi / Assistants-Pi per avviare gli assistenti all'avvio.

E questo è tutto. Il tuo altoparlante smart 2 in 1 è pronto. Inoltre, mentre è possibile utilizzare l'intero setup barebone, abbiamo deciso di avvolgere le cose all'interno di una bella scatola di cartone e di applicare una carta nera per grafici mentre Beebom-ify-up. Puoi anche vedere il nostro video dello stesso sotto, per vedere il nostro interlocutore in azione:

VEDERE ANCHE: Google Home contro Amazon Echo: Assistente Google riprende Alexa

Lo Smart Speaker fai da te: il meglio di entrambi i mondi

Bene, so che puoi acquistare il tuo Amazon Echo Dot e Google Home Mini, ma potresti anche essere consapevole che questi prodotti non sono disponibili ovunque. Inoltre, con la guida sopra puoi creare un altoparlante che ti dà la potenza di entrambi gli assistenti vocali combinati in un unico dispositivo. Oh, e i progetti fai-da-te non sono sempre divertenti? So che mi è piaciuto molto fare il mio oratore intelligente, e il risultato finale è stato più che soddisfacente. Ma tu? Condividete con noi la vostra esperienza nel costruire il vostro altoparlante intelligente nei commenti in basso.

Top